Look to book a parade lap. There are either 30mph or 60mph parade sessions you can buy - these have a lead car which paces you and there are fewer cars on the circuit so you are spread out. Other types of sessions you will be mixing it with some fast cars - to be avoided as a novice and if you value your car. There is a free parade lap open to all entrants to the event - this is at a slow pace with a lot more cars on track but is still a good experience.

Also, ensure that you have valid insurance to take your mini onto the track even if it is just a parade lap. Previously when I used to be into Fords, we completed a parade lap at SIlverstone however a Sierra suffered a whack and it was a very sticky situation.
